Articles of Ubuntu

asm / timex.h和get_cycles()哪里去了?

在较旧的Linux发行版中,我可以在包含asm / timex.h之后调用get_cycle()。 现在我改成了Kubuntu 9.04,没有asm / timex.h,加上sys / timex.h中没有get_cycle()。 有谁知道为什么这个改变,如何访问这个函数/macros或replace它? 或者,甚至更好,在哪里阅读关于它的信息?

在Linux下使用USB导弹启动器进行编程

刚刚拿到了这些: http : //www.pearl.de/a-PE5858-1413.shtml 我想开始编程这些,但我找不到任何可用的东西。 我正在使用Ubuntu Jaunty 9.04。 问题是我找不到太多的样本和模块等等。

libdb4.6-dev与libdb4.7-dev

我想在Ubuntu Intrepid上安装PHP 5.3。 要安装apxs,我需要安装依赖于libdb4.6-dev的libaprutil1-dev。 当我看着安装,apt-get想要删除当前安装的libdb-dev和libdb4.7-dev。 有关如何进行的任何build议? [root@server:/usr/local] #> apt-get -s install libaprutil1-dev Reading package lists… Done Building dependency tree Reading state information… Done Some packages could not be installed. This may mean that you have requested an impossible situation or if you are using the unstable distribution that some required packages have not yet been […]

连接到特定无线networking时运行命令

在我的大学里,有一个为学生和员工开放的无线networking。 然而,要使用它,必须首先使用您自己的用户名和密码通过网站login。 这也可以通过向正确的POST数据提交一个http请求到同一个网站来完成。 我已经有一个shell脚本,但我仍然好奇,是否有可能让这个脚本自动运行,每当我的计算机连接到大学无线局域网。 是否有可能以一种简单的方式做到这一点?

使用tar来压缩日志目录,当压缩期间apache尝试写入时会发生什么?

我想运行一个cron并每小时压缩我的/ var / log目录到一个tar文件..所以我可以备份该文件。 会发生什么事日志文件的确切时刻我运行tar命令,我会错过这些日志行或不同的软件运行和使用/ var / log等待,或将焦油被破坏等? 我有一个繁忙的networking服务器,所以它每秒钟多次写入日志文件。 我打算跑步 tar -zcf /home/user/file_date.tar /var/log

通过cron运行django的python脚本

我有一个连接到外部主机的Python脚本,获取一些数据,并用数据填充Django数据库。 填充数据库的python脚本使用这些行来设置django环境: path = os.path.normpath(os.path.join(os.getcwd(), '..')) sys.path.append(path) from django.core.management import setup_environ import settings setup_environ(settings) 然后我有一个实际运行python脚本的shell脚本: export PYTHONPATH=$PYTHONPATH:/home/django/project_dir/ cd ~/project_dir/scripts/ ~/virtualenv/bin/python my_script.py 然后我的cronconfiguration,放在/etc/cron.d/ 0 1 * * * django ~/project_dir/scripts/my_script.sh > /var/log/django_cron.log 请注意,django项目有它自己的用户和虚拟环境。 当我以django用户login时,shell脚本运行正常。 但是cron不会运行! 我在日志文件中没有错误。 我相信这是非常简单的事情,但我只是没有看到它…

软件包,Ubuntu对应的Gentoo有用的命令

试图学习如何在Ubuntu中使用软件包(并具有Gentoo经验)。 这个命令是已知的: (1) sudo apt-get install pkgname 寻找这些的同行: (2) emerge -s pkgname (3) equery files pkgname (4) equery belongs filename (5) cat /var/lib/portage world 在Ubuntu中使用哪些有用的(控制台)包命令? 用Gentoo手册的方式链接到Ubuntu包教程?

在Ubuntu linux下用C / C ++编程

如何显示在Ubuntu的每个分区的开始部分?就像在Windows中有一个API调用C / C ++的磁盘结构..任何build议将帮助完整。

从命令响应中提取数据并将其存储在variables中

我想在启动过程中使用这样的脚本禁用我的触摸板 #!/bin/bash #确定设备ID ID = $(xinput list | grep -i touchpad) #检查输出 echo $ ID #禁用$ ID标识的设备 #inputset-prop $ ID“设备已启用”0 </ code> 基本上我想从命令的结果中提取“12”(或任何设备号码): xinput列表| grep -i触摸板 ↳↳SynPS / 2 Synaptics触摸板id = 12 [从指针(2)] 并将其存储在variables$ ID中。 下一个命令将禁用该设备。 任何build议,我怎么能实现呢? 谢谢,Udo

上传文件function在Ubuntu中不起作用

我做了一个基于Flex + PHP的应用程序,其中有一个function可以将图片上传到服务器。 如果在Windows上运行,该应用程序会上传照片。 但在Ubuntu上,文件根本就没有上传。 它可以是权限相关的问题? 这是上传文件时保留的日志: Uploading 5408_1243356204478_1246540615_30751024_3730562_n.jpg… File opened File upload in progress (349 of 31340) File upload in progress (349 of 31340) File upload in progress (31340 of 31340) File upload in progress (31340 of 31340) File upload in progress (31340 of 31340) File upload in progress (31340 of 31340) File upload […]